Second league defeat on the spin for Comrades

Ballyclare Comrades suffered their second league defeat on the spin as they went down 4-1 at Donegal Celtic.

Samuel McIlveen scored the Reds’ only goal of the game six minutes from time, but it proved to be mere consolation. The Wee Hoops were already three goals to the good when McIlveen scored and they added a fourth two minutes later to wrap up the three points.

DC’s goalscorers were Anto McGonnell, Patrick Kelly, Denver Taggart and Ryan Dunlop.

The two sides meet again at Suffolk Road next weekend in round four of the Irish Cup.

Flood, Doherty, Doyle, Gage, Buckley (Gray 48), Agnew, McIlveen, McCart, Cooper, Simpson (Reid 45), Trussell (Brown 69). Subs not used: McGowan, Hill.
